İleri Proxy'ler Açıklandı: Avantajlar ve Kullanım Örnekleri

İleri Proxy'ler Açıklandı: Avantajlar ve Kullanım Örnekleri

İleri Vekilleri Anlamak

İleri proxy'ler, istemciler ve internet arasında aracı görevi görerek, bir kullanıcının cihazı ile hedef sunucu arasındaki istek ve yanıtları aracılık eder. İstemcilerin diğer ağ hizmetlerine dolaylı ağ bağlantıları kurmasına olanak tanıyan bir ağ geçidi görevi görür, çok sayıda avantaj sağlar ve çeşitli kullanım durumlarını karşılar.

İleri Proxy'ler Nasıl Çalışır

Bir ileri proxy sunucusu, dahili istemcilerden gelen istekleri alır ve bunları harici sunuculara iletir. Bu süreç birkaç adıma ayrılabilir:

  1. Müşteri Talebi:İstemci proxy sunucusuna bir istek gönderir.
  2. Proxy İşleme: Proxy sunucusu isteği değerlendirir, potansiyel olarak başlıkları değiştirir veya kimlik doğrulaması gerçekleştirir.
  3. Talebin İletilmesi: Proxy, değiştirilen isteği hedef sunucuya gönderir.
  4. Yanıt İşleme: Hedef sunucu proxy'ye yanıt verir, proxy de yanıtı istemciye iletir.
Client -> Proxy Server -> Target Server -> Proxy Server -> Client

İleri Proxy'lerin Faydaları

Anonimlik ve Gizlilik

İleri proxy'ler istemcinin IP adresini maskeleyerek anonimlik sağlayabilir. İstekleri bir proxy üzerinden yönlendirerek istemcinin kimliği hedef sunucudan gizli kalır.

Erişim Kontrolü

Proxy'ler, trafiği filtreleyerek kurumsal politikaları uygulayabilir. Belirli web sitelerine veya içeriklere erişimi engelleyerek kurumsal veya düzenleyici standartlara uyumu sağlayabilir.

Bant Genişliği Optimizasyonu

Sık erişilen içerikleri önbelleğe alarak, yönlendirme proxy'leri bant genişliği kullanımını azaltır ve erişim sürelerini hızlandırır, böylece ağ performansını artırır.

Güvenlik Geliştirme

İleri proxy'ler kötü amaçlı içeriği filtreleyerek ve dahili ağa doğrudan erişimi engelleyerek ek bir güvenlik katmanı ekler. Ayrıca kullanıcı kimliklerini doğrulamak için kimlik doğrulamayı zorunlu kılabilir.

İleri Proxy'ler için Kullanım Örnekleri

İçerik Filtreleme

Kuruluşlar, iş dışı web sitelerine erişimi kısıtlamak, üretkenliği artırmak ve güvenli bir tarama ortamı sağlamak için ileri proxy'leri kullanırlar.

Coğrafi Kısıtlama Baypası

İleri proxy'ler, kullanıcıların izin verilen bölgelerdeki sunucular üzerinden istekleri yönlendirerek belirli coğrafi konumlarla sınırlı içeriklere erişmesini sağlar.

Yük Dengeleme

İstekleri birden fazla sunucuya dağıtarak, ileri proxy'ler trafik yüklerini verimli bir şekilde yönetebilir, tutarlı kullanılabilirlik ve performans sağlayabilir.

Uzaktan Çalışanlar İçin Gelişmiş Gizlilik

Uzaktan çalışanlar, kurumsal kaynaklara erişirken bağlantılarını güvence altına almak için yönlendirme proxy'lerini kullanabilir ve böylece veri ele geçirme riskini azaltabilirler.

Teknik Uygulama

NGINX ile İleri Proxy Kurulumu

Aşağıda NGINX kullanarak ileri proxy sunucusu kurmak için temel bir yapılandırma bulunmaktadır:

http {
    server {
        listen 8080;

        location / {
            proxy_pass http://$http_host$request_uri;
            proxy_set_header Host $http_host;
            proxy_set_header X-Real-IP $remote_addr;
            pro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
        }
    }
}
Uygulama Adımları
  1. NGINX'i yükleyin: Sunucunuzda NGINX'in kurulu olduğundan emin olun.
  2. Yapılandırmayı Değiştir: Yukarıdaki proxy ayarlarını içerecek şekilde NGINX yapılandırma dosyasını düzenleyin.
  3. NGINX'i Başlat: Değişiklikleri uygulamak için NGINX servisini yeniden başlatın.
sudo systemctl restart nginx

Karşılaştırma Tablosu: İleri Proxy ve Ters Proxy

Özellik İleri Proxy Ters Proxy
Müşteriye Yönelik Evet HAYIR
Sunucuya Yönelik HAYIR Evet
Birincil Kullanım Anonimlik, filtreleme, önbelleğe alma Yük dengeleme, güvenlik, SSL boşaltma
İstemci IP Maskelemesi Evet HAYIR
Tipik Dağıtım İstemci tarafı Sunucu tarafı

Çözüm

İleri proxy'lerin teknik inceliklerini ve pratik uygulamalarını anlayarak, kuruluşlar bu araçları güvenliği artırmak, bant genişliğini optimize etmek ve uyumluluğu sağlamak için kullanabilirler. Düşünceli bir uygulama ile ileri proxy'ler, hem esneklik hem de kontrol sunarak modern ağ mimarisinde güçlü bir varlık görevi görür.

Zivadin Petroviç

Zivadin Petroviç

Proxy Entegrasyon Uzmanı

Dijital gizlilik ve veri yönetimi alanında parlak ve yenilikçi bir zihin olan Zivadin Petrovic, ProxyRoller'da Proxy Entegrasyon Uzmanı olarak görev yapıyor. Henüz 22 yaşında olan Zivadin, verimli proxy dağıtımı için akıcı sistemlerin geliştirilmesine önemli katkılarda bulundu. Rolü, ProxyRoller'ın kapsamlı proxy listelerini düzenlemek ve yönetmek, gelişmiş tarama, kazıma ve gizlilik çözümleri arayan kullanıcıların dinamik ihtiyaçlarını karşılamalarını sağlamaktır.

Yorumlar (0)

Burada henüz yorum yok, ilk siz olabilirsiniz!

Bir yanıt yazın

E-posta adresiniz yayınlanmayacak. Gerekli alanlar * ile işaretlenmişlerdir